That's Tunze's older line of skimmers. I use a 240/3 and it skims just fine. The approach is completely different than the latest tendency to skim the snot out of your aquarium.

It's venturi design is small, compact and efficient. I wouldn't put it into a full out high-end SPS system, but it will do fine with anything else.

I used to run a mesh-modded ER 6-2 which is a little bit undersized for my system. The 240/3 pulls out just as much stuff while using less electricity, being a bit quieter and taking up a lot less space. The ER also used to go nuts and overflow after the meshmod whenever I fed anything oily like mysis, which got really annoying. The Tunze simply stops foaming for a few hours.

If you're looking at a new Tunze skimmer, their 9010, 9015, 9020 line is probably a better choice.
